'Living up to name': Beed's 'Little Sachin' living his father's dream

His 96-run knock, along with skipper Uday Saharan's 81, was a key factor in ensuring that India sneaked into the U-19 World Cup final for a fifth consecutive time

His police officer mother didn't want cricket to be Sachin Dhas' focus in life but the father knew that he was destined to make it big on the 22-yard strip despite spending a better part of his life training on 11-yard grass tracks that pass for infrastructure in his hometown Beed.

The 19-year-old Dhas is among the brightest prospects to emerge in the Indian team that is competing in the U-19 World Cup in South Africa. He has displayed superb game sense as the team's designated finisher with 294 runs at an above 100 strike rate.
